Which is right for you?
Choose Hydroponics if…
- Watching roots dangle and lettuce shoot up twice as fast hooks you.
- Checking pH and nutrient levels feels like a satisfying puzzle, not a chore.
- Tuning a little growing machine until it almost runs itself appeals to you.
Choose Terrarium Making if…
- Layering gravel, soil, and moss into a tiny green world satisfies you.
- You enjoy reading condensation to know when to crack the lid.
- A sealed jar that finally finds its own equilibrium would please you.

Before you commit
Hydroponics
- You want gardening simple, not pH chemistry and failed pumps.
- Algae or root rot wiping a setup out in days would gut you.
- Daily reservoir checks would feel like homework you didn't sign up for.
Terrarium Making
- A few rotted or browned attempts before balance would frustrate you.
- You want fast visible change, not slow subtle growth under glass.
- Plants that refuse to grow as planned would just annoy you.
